Causes

Erb's Palsy occurs when the bundle (the brachialplexus) of nerves in the neck is damaged. These nerves control shoulder, arm, and hand movements and sensation. Patients suffering from Erb's palsy may experience weakness, numbness or paralysis in one arm and shoulder.

This condition may result from various medical mistakes during labor and birth, including forceps use or a C-section that was performed too early or a doctor misusing a vacuum extractor during vaginal birth. However, a majority of cases of erb's syndrome are completely preventable. Doctors, nurses and midwives as well as other medical professionals, are required to ensure a high level of medical care in the birthing room. They must ensure that the shoulders of the baby are delivered through the vaginal canal and that they do not become stuck or lodged into the pelvic bones of the mother's.

Researchers have suggested that the condition may be caused by maternal contractions or the position of pregnant women. However these theories have not been confirmed. Diagnosis

Erb's Palsy is caused due to injuries to the brachialplexus which is a network of nerves that run through the arm and shoulder. These nerves can be stretched or strained by a difficult delivery. Signs of this disorder include weakness or paralysis in the affected arm. Doctors are responsible for properly diagnosing this condition as quickly as possible.

The most frequent reason is childbirth difficulties. This is typically the case when a fetus's size is greater than what is expected for vaginal birth or when the baby's shoulders get stuck during birth. This is known as shoulder dystocia and it is one of the main risk factors for Erb's palsy.

If a physician uses excessive force or fails to identify the shoulder dystocia, it may result in injury to the upper nerves of the brachial plexus. This causes Erb's Palsy. If the doctor's negligence is the cause then he or she could be held accountable for any permanent harm.

Treatment

In most instances, it is better to treat and diagnose the condition immediately. Untreated, the condition can lead to permanent tightening of muscles (contractures) or even total or partial paralysis. Surgery and physical therapy are the most popular treatments.

A physician may have to use a certain amount force during a difficult delivery in order to assist the baby through the birth canal. When doing this they could accidentally stretch the baby's neck which could cause damage to the nerves.

Doctors can use a variety of tests, like X-rays and ultrasounds, as well as a physical examination to determine the severity of the injury and the extent of the nerve damage. A doctor might prescribe medications to ease discomfort and pain as well as occupational therapy or physical therapy to restore movement.
